🤔 Why Do Kids Need Special Cough Syrups?
Let’s face it—kids aren’t just tiny adults! Their immune systems are still developing, and their bodies react differently to medications.
For instance, did you know that over-the-counter (OTC) cough syrups can be risky for kids under six? The FDA warns against them because of potential side effects like drowsiness or hyperactivity. Yikes! 😱 Instead, pediatricians often recommend safer alternatives tailored specifically for kiddos. So, before you grab that colorful bottle off the shelf, take a moment to read the label carefully. 👀
🍯 Honey: Nature’s Sweet Solution
Honey is one of the most underrated heroes in the world of kid-friendly remedies. Not only does it taste amazing (hello, sweetness!), but studies show it can soothe sore throats and reduce nighttime coughing. 🌟 But here’s the deal: never give honey to babies under one year old due to botulism risks. For older kids, mix a teaspoon with warm water or herbal tea for an instant feel-good fix. Plus, who doesn’t love turning medicine time into dessert time? 🍯😋

🌱 Natural Remedies: Beyond Cough Syrup
If you’re looking to go full-on hippie-chic, there are plenty of natural remedies worth trying. Steam therapy, saline nasal sprays, and humidifiers can work wonders for loosening mucus and easing congestion.
